Final Recommendation

Both Mellum2 and Rasa are completely open-source solutions with no licensing costs, making them equally accessible from a pricing perspective. However, they differ fundamentally in deployment model: Mellum2 is a standalone language model you download and run locally, while Rasa is a framework you integrate into your application architecture. Neither requires API access for core functionality, though both can be extended with additional services depending on your setup needs.

Mellum2 excels as a general-purpose language model optimized for coding tasks and efficient inference through its mixture-of-experts design, making it ideal if you need a capable backbone for various NLP applications. Rasa shines specifically for conversational AI, providing pre-built dialogue management, natural language understanding, and multi-turn conversation handling out of the box—all essential infrastructure for chatbots that would require additional development with Mellum2.

Pick Mellum2 if you need a versatile, efficient language model for general tasks including code generation or want to build custom conversational systems from scratch. Pick Rasa if you're specifically building chatbots or voice assistants and want a framework that handles conversation flow, context management, and dialogue logic without building these systems yourself.
